PHP execution via widget file write
Published Aug 20, 2026 · Updated Aug 20, 2026
Code injection in Royal Addons for Elementor before 1.7.1066 allows remote authenticated users to execute arbitrary PHP via Widget Builder. The plugin does not sanitize custom widget markup before writing it into a file that is later executed, so attacker-supplied PHP embedded in the widget definition runs on the server. Reachability requires the manage_options capability; on WordPress Multisite, subsite administrators can hit the flaw even without the broader code-execution privileges normally limited to super admins.
